Change the oil regularly:

Oil plays a role of blood for your car. It is important for you to change the oil when it is required. Car service providers say that it’s recommended that you must change the oil after every 3000 Miles. This will keep the engine smooth and will let it work for a longer period of time. Fix the problems on time:

It is very common that people do not give importance to the warning signals in the car and thus they shorten their cars’ lifespan without knowing. Thus for your car to provide you service for a longer period of time, you must check the problem out whenever a warning signal is shown.

Check the car weekly:

Once in a week you should check the car if everything is working properly or not. Before going out on drive do check the engine oil, radiator water, brakes oil etc. By checking these things just once in a week can be helpful for your vehicle and it will surely provide you service for much longer time. Similarly do check other things like air of the tires and working of the brakes.
